Janyce (Fale) Kerkhoff, age 74, of Ashwaubenon, passed away on Monday, February 15, 2016.She was born on December 18, 1941 in Sheboygan, the second oldest of thirteen children to Adolph & Harriette (Schultz) Fale. Janyce graduated from Central High School in the class of 1960 in Sheboygan.She married Dennis Oehldrich in 1961 and had four great children together, David, Debbie, Dan and Denise. While in Sheboygan, she worked at Lakeland Manufacturing and Wigwam Manufacturing. While in the Green Bay area, she worked at Family Services, retiring in 1994. Janyce married Andrew Kerkhoff in 1996. She was a volunteer and served on the Allocation Committee at the United Way, was past Vice President while volunteering at the Volunteer Center and was an advocate for victims of sexual assault while volunteering at the Sexual Assault Center. Janyce was an active member at St. Agnes Parish, also of the Brown County Community Women's Club. Her and her husband, Andy, were members of the Green Bay Yacht Club. She was a Packer and Brewer fan. She loved to garden, play cards, cook, spend time with her family, especially the grandkids and great-grandkids.
